¿Cómo asignar a un label en un Userform el valor de una celda en la hoja de Excel?

Nuevamente recurro a tus conocimientos. ¿Cómo puedo hacer para que un label que tengo en un Userform se asigne automáticamente el valor de una celda en una hoja de cálculo del mismo libro en el cual esta el Userform?

1 respuesta

Respuesta
7

Sería algo como el siguiente ejemplo:

label1.caption = range("a1").value

En esta línea estamos asignando al label1 el contenido de la celda A1

No olvides finalizar la consulta

Hola Luis,

Funciona bien pero sólo al dar clics sobre la etiqueta, ¿puede hacerse de forma automática?

Claro, puedes ponerlo dentro del evento INITIALIZE entonces se cargará siempre en el momento de iniciar el form, sería así:

Private Sub UserForm_Initialize()
label1.Caption = Range("a1").Value
End Sub



Recuerda finalizar

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as